For 20 years, Northern Michigan’s 4-piece band Song of the Lakes has served as ambassadors of the Great Lakes musical tradition.

Using an array of acoustic instruments, Song of the Lakes adds to Michigan folklore with original tunes that expand on Celtic, Scandinavian and maritime styles.
